From The Internet To The Airport: Scammers At Work

If It Sounds Too Good To Be True...

Let's say you're trying to sell your plane. You're asking $50,000 for it -- but so far, no one has bitten, and you're getting a little desperate.

Then one day, you get a call offering $55,000 -- on the condition that you send a check back to the buyer for $5,000. Would you do it?

Of course, it's a scam... but it's one that has apparently bitten quite a few pilots nationwide, according to the Aircraft Owners and Pilot's Association.

AOPA says you'll get an authentic-looking check in the mail, at which point you're expected to send off your own check for the $5,000 difference --  only to find the buyer's check is no good.

Best defense in this case, says AOPA, is to find out if the buyer's check is good before you proceed. And in any case, it may not be such a great idea to do this kind of cashback deal in the first place.
